程序員這個職業往往給很多人的印象是壹個工資很高但是經常加班的工作996。很多朋友想入行但是又擔心又累。作為壹名程序員,我來說說程序員職業的真實情況。
我對程序員職業的理解主要有以下幾個特點。
總覺得,軟件開發涉及很多邏輯判斷、設計、優化等等,需要經常思考。每壹個軟件系統都是程序員智慧和經驗的結晶。
更多的討論,大型軟件是多人團隊完成的,所以需要大量的溝通來保證軟件開發的全生命周期。
追求設計和編碼,結合業務要領,設計追求優雅易懂的代碼。
隨著不斷學習,it技術快速叠代更新。程序員需要深入到各種底層技術中去學習,打好堅實的基礎,同時保持自己的技術棧眼界的更新。
那麽真正的程序員累嗎?
總的來說,程序員是壹個腦力活動,從軟件設計開發到bug調查都需要思考。但對於真正熱愛it知識和技術的程序員來說,他們在工作中往往不會覺得累,反而有不斷的動力去迎接挑戰,思考問題,解決問題。所以累不累,取決於妳是否熱愛這個職業,這和其他行業壹樣。我身邊也有很多優秀的程序員,他們在出色完成本職工作的同時,花大量的業余時間學習新技術,思考升級。相反,如果只是追求高工資,久而久之就會很累。
妳每天要工作多長時間?
這個主要看項目和公司規定。常見的情況是上午9點到下午6點。主要是根據項目的進度,在項目的初步設計和分析階段不會有太多的加班,如果從開發期到交付期進度非常快,也會像業內說的那樣加班。在項目上線後的維護期,根據系統的穩定狀態判斷是否需要加班維護。但是很多程序員會選擇加班學習技術,提高自己的能力,保持工作後的競爭力。
以上是程序員的真實情況,希望對妳有幫助。